Question 1: A contractor wants to raise the car speed from

100fpm to 125fpm, it currently has a 12" sheave. What sheave is required? Diam=12" 12/4=3" 25fpm=3" 100fpm + 25fpm= 12"+3"= 15" sheave

CORRECT ANSWER : 15" sheave

Question 2: A MOV (Metal Oxide Varistor) burns out. You

replace it, but cannot read voltage or resistance. What should you do?

CORRECT ANSWER : Replace it with a larger MOV

Question 4: You have an old DC motor and are adding an SCR

drive, what do you do to the interpoles?

CORRECT ANSWER : Leave the interpoles alone. When

adding a SCR drive to the generator, the series loop is removed, as are the 3 resistors. Everything else remains the same

Question 5: A hydro runs up with no load, but will not run with

a full load. What is the issue?

CORRECT ANSWER : The relief valve is set too low

Question 6: Runby for a 1:1 hits the CWT buffer 4" below the top landing. CWT runby should be set at 18". How much should the ropes be shortened?

CORRECT ANSWER : 22"

Question 8: The contractor requests that the vertical center of a

Rack and Pinion hoist be moved. How do you do this?

CORRECT ANSWER : Adjust Tie Downs and Wall Ties

Question 9: Working pressure on a Hydro is 400psi. What is the

maximum relief valve setting?

CORRECT ANSWER : 400psi x 150%= 600psi

Question 10: What must be installed on a false car before

operation?

CORRECT ANSWER : Spring Loaded Safeties
